How To Write A Cover Letter For A Finance Job
Crafting an Effective Cover Letter for a Finance Job with BestResumeHelp.com
Introduction: When applying for a finance job, a well-crafted cover letter can significantly enhance your chances of standing out in a competitive job market. Addressing the Hiring Manager: Begin your cover letter by addressing the hiring manager or recruiter directly. If you can't find their name in the job listing, take the time to research and find the appropriate contact. Personalizing your salutation adds a professional touch to your application.
Opening Paragraph: In the opening paragraph, express your enthusiasm for the finance job position. Mention how you learned about the job opening and briefly highlight your interest in the company. This sets a positive tone and captures the reader's attention from the start.
Showcasing Your Finance Skills: The body of your cover letter should focus on showcasing your relevant finance skills and experiences. Tailor your content to align with the specific requirements outlined in the job description. Use concrete examples to demonstrate your achievements and contributions in previous roles.
Highlighting Achievements: Quantify your accomplishments to provide a clear understanding of your impact in previous positions. Use metrics, percentages, or specific figures to highlight your achievements, making your cover letter more persuasive and impactful.
Connecting with Company Values: Research the company's values, mission, and culture. In the cover letter, demonstrate how your values align with the company's and how your skills can contribute to achieving its goals. This shows the hiring manager that you've taken the time to understand their organization.
Expressing Your Motivation: Explain why you are interested in working for the company and how the finance role aligns with your career goals. Demonstrating a genuine interest in the company and the position helps create a connection with the reader.
Closing Paragraph: Conclude your cover letter by expressing your eagerness for an interview to further discuss your qualifications. Include a call-to-action, inviting the employer to contact you to schedule a meeting. Thank the hiring manager for considering your application and express your excitement about the opportunity.
